The Emergency Department Associate plays a crucial role in providing direct and indirect patient care within the fast-paced environment of the Emergency Department at Thomas Memorial Hospital, part of the WVU Medicine network. This position supports registered nurses and licensed medical providers in a variety of procedures and patient care activities, ensuring patients receive timely and efficient care. The Emergency Department Associate contributes to a safe and clean environment while upholding the highest standards of patient safety and quality.

The minimum qualifications include a High School Diploma or equivalent and Basic Life Support (BLS) certification within 30 days of hire.
Preferred qualifications include certification as a West Virginia Emergency Medical Technician/Paramedic or applicable state licensure, certification in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S), certification in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S), and two years of college in an applicable course of study or two years’ experience in an Emergency Department or pre-hospital setting.
Core duties include observing and reporting patient conditions, assisting with patient care activities, recording vital signs, assisting with specimen collection, maintaining a clean environment, and assisting with administrative tasks.
The physical demands include standing, walking, lifting, bending, and stooping.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.
